    Re: OFFICIAL: New 991.2 GT3

    Grant:
     

    If the tires are N1, that is same compound as RS (but RS has bigger tires).  So, it's over 7 sec. faster than RS with same power, torque, tire compound (but smaller ones), gearing, and less downforce.

    Somehow, I think the new motor is a monster (despite same ratings as R and RS).  Having 9k redline will help in itself (higher rpm after an upshift)

    Suspension tuning must be very good too...

     

     

    Actually I think Pirelli and Porsche do those N rating differently depending on sizing. 

    My 911R came with N0 Cup2s.Standard on GT4 and others. They are the the normal sticky version. Not like the ECO rated N0 in RS sizing for 918.

    I believe the new GT3 will have the N1 but these N1 will be more advanced than the RS's N1. As in even stickier.

    Re: OFFICIAL: New 991.2 GT3

    DaveC:

    LWB replaced by race seat for this series of runs.  I gather if one is serious about tracking the LWBs are equal to the standard sport seats, equally unsuitable?

    LWB's hold you better that sport seats, are height adjustable, allow for 6-point harnesses, and have factory airbags (unlike race seats)


    --

    73 Carrera RS 2.7 Carbon Fiber replica (1,890 lbs), 06 EVO9 with track mods. Former: 16 Cayman GT4, 73 911S, Two 951S's, 996 C2, 993 C2, 98 Ferrari 550, 79 635CSi


    Re: OFFICIAL: New 991.2 GT3

    LWB are a good dual purpose seat, but for many, the amount of support you get from a real seat is far greater.  Halo for the head is a nice safety feature.  But, besides the lack of an airbag, a full race seat is nearly unusable on the street.

    So you have to choose the compromise that works best for you.
